Cost of Paver Driveway Installation in West Bloomfield

If you're considering a paver driveway installation in West Bloomfield, MI, understanding the cost factors and common expenses can help you plan your budget effectively. From material choices to labor costs, several elements influence the overall price of your driveway project.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Material Type: The choice of pavers (concrete, brick, or natural stone) can significantly influence the cost.
  • Driveway Size: Larger driveways require more materials and labor, increasing the total expense.
  • Site Preparation: The need for excavation, grading, or removal of old materials can add to the cost.
  • Design Complexity: Intricate patterns or custom designs often require more time and expertise, leading to higher costs.
  • Labor Rates: Local labor rates in West Bloomfield, MI, can vary, impacting the overall cost.
  • Permits and Inspections: Obtaining necessary permits and passing inspections can add to the cost.
  • Drainage Solutions: Installing proper drainage systems to prevent water pooling may incur additional expenses.

Average Costs for Common Tasks and Costs

Task/Item Average Cost (West Bloomfield, MI)
Basic Concrete Pavers $10 - $15 per square foot
Basic Brick Pavers $12 - $20 per square foot
Natural Stone Pavers $20 - $30 per square foot
Excavation and Grading $1,000 - $3,000
Installation Labor $3 - $7 per square foot
Permits and Inspections $100 - $500
Drainage Solutions $500 - $2,000
Sealing and Finishing $1 - $3 per square foot

Understanding these factors and costs can help you make an informed decision for your paver driveway installation in West Bloomfield, MI.
